ATM 3-leg butterfly for a defined-risk directional bet. Delta-targeted body strike. TP in fixed dollars. Placed via dashboard on demand.
Credit BWB (put or call) with asymmetric wings. Net credit entry, defined max loss, uncapped profit on a small move.
Records the 08:30–09:00 CST opening range. Breakout above → 3 DTE call butterfly. Breakout below → 3 DTE put butterfly. No breakout by 10:00 → sits out for the day. No cap on concurrent positions — each butterfly's risk is capped at its own small debit.
Fires when VIX spikes vs the day's open. Places a 3 DTE butterfly in the implied direction — call butterfly on a VIX drop, put butterfly on a VIX spike. One position at a time.
Two 7 DTE butterflies at once — one call, one put — straddling today's spot. Profits from a move toward either side. 84% win rate, $114K backtested P&L across 2022–2023.
TBT VIX filtering selects high-volatility downtrend regimes. Wide OTM credit spread entered only when conditions align.
4-leg symmetric IC anchored to the prior close. Enters at 08:35 CST. TP at 35%, SL at 200% of initial credit.
Buys a 40-delta ATM-ish call butterfly at ~3 DTE, entering Mondays only to capture SPX's historical Monday drift. TP at 2.5x the debit paid. 76.9% win rate backtested across 2022–2023.
Tom Sosnoff's original trade — sells a 45 DTE naked /ES put and holds to 21 DTE. Now running TBT AI-optimized parameters for best risk-adjusted return.
Defined-risk version of the Tom Trade — sells an OTM /ES put spread at 45 DTE, long put 75 pts further OTM. Same 21 DTE time exit, fraction of the naked put's buying power requirement.
Stacks up to 10 long-dated /ES put spreads, one per week. Ratcheting adjustment logic. Slow-burn premium decay.
Unbalanced IC with a wide put spread (30 pts) and tight call spread (10 pts). Short strikes placed one expected move OTM on each side. No stop-loss — call-side risk is nearly covered by the put credit.
Sells a near-term /ES put and buys a further-dated /ES put at the same ATM strike. Net debit — profits from the short leg decaying faster. VIX-filtered entry; runs on /ES instead of SPX since the identical structure needs roughly 2x the debit paid in buying power here, versus over $100k on the index.
On-demand credit spread on any symbol and DTE. Delta-targeted or exact strike. Full TP/SL/time-exit management once placed.
On-demand 4-leg Iron Condor on any symbol and DTE. Sells OTM put spread and call spread simultaneously as a single credit order. Delta-targeted strikes; combined TP/SL/time-exit management.
